To connect your Hoover HRTPSJ644DCWIFI to your home Wi-Fi, first ensure the appliance is powered on. Press the Wi-Fi button on the control panel until the Wi-Fi indicator begins to blink. Use the Hoover Wizard app on your smartphone to search for the device and follow the on-screen instructions to complete the connection process.
If your Hoover HRTPSJ644DCWIFI is not cooling properly, check if the temperature settings are correct. Ensure the doors are closing properly and that they are not blocked by any food items. Also, clean the condenser coils at the back of the refrigerator as dust accumulation can affect cooling efficiency.
To change the temperature settings, use the control panel on the front of the refrigerator. Press the temperature button to toggle between different settings for the fridge and freezer compartments. Adjust as necessary and the new settings will be saved automatically.
Regular maintenance for the Hoover HRTPSJ644DCWIFI includes cleaning the condenser coils every six months, checking door seals for any damage, and ensuring the drainage hole at the back of the fridge is clear of debris. It's also advisable to defrost the freezer if the ice build-up is significant.
To reset your Hoover HRTPSJ644DCWIFI after a power outage, unplug the appliance from the power source and wait for about 5 minutes. Plug it back in and press the power button to restart it. Ensure that the Wi-Fi connection is reestablished if needed.
Unusual noises from your Hoover HRTPSJ644DCWIFI could be due to the appliance not being level, which causes vibrations. Ensure it is sitting on a flat surface. Additionally, check for any loose items inside the fridge that might be causing the noise. If the noise persists, contact customer support.
Download the Hoover Wizard app from the App Store or Google Play Store. Connect your appliance to Wi-Fi as instructed in the manual. Once connected, open the app and follow the prompts to sync your HRTPSJ644DCWIFI. The app will allow you to control settings and monitor performance remotely.
Refer to the user manual for error code definitions. Common solutions include resetting the appliance, checking power connections, and ensuring proper door closure. If the issue persists, contact Hoover customer support with the error code details for further assistance.
To clean the water dispenser, turn off the water supply and remove the dispenser tray. Use a mild cleaning solution and a soft cloth to clean the tray and the spout. Rinse thoroughly with water before reassembling the parts.
Yes, the shelving in the Hoover HRTPSJ644DCWIFI is adjustable. To rearrange the shelves, lift the front of the shelf and pull it out. Position it at the desired height and slide it back into place. Ensure it is securely seated before placing items on it.
